Default front end chattering

My 96 ES (90k) over the past 6 mos. began vibrating and chattering in the front end up and down and side to side after driving over a short stretch of rough road at over 50 mph. I pulled over, shut off the engine checked the tires, got back in and drove off with no further vibrations. The last time, I pulled over but I didn't shut the engine off and it continued to vibrate even at low speeds so I pulled over again and shut the engine off, restarted and continued with no vibrations. My mechanic could find nothing wrong with tires or linkages, etc. Any ideas?

Default RE: front end chattering

the most common things on the suspension vibration issues are
the steering rack bushings, control arm bushings,
tie rod ends, worn or cupped tires
but tires would always make noise
you can lift your front end up with a jack
put jack stands under the front control arms
be careful to position them well enough not the fall
then give a tug on the tire in two motions
pull tire back and forth from top to bottom(up/dowwn)
and the same for side to side (left/right)

if you feel any loosness ,
you know you got a problem with the suspension or steering
and you can trace the movement back to the bad part
